How Our Water Heater Leak Water Removal Service Works
Our process is designed to reduce disruption and get your home back to normal as quickly as possible. We start by assessing the damage, identifying the source of the leak, and developing a customized plan to remove the water and dry your property.
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
We’ll evaluate the extent of the damage, check for any signs of mold or mildew, and create a detailed plan to extract the water and dry your property. Our team will also identify any potential safety hazards and take steps to mitigate them.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use commercial-grade pumps and extractors to remove as much water as possible from your property. Our technicians will work efficiently to reduce downtime and get your home back to normal.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We’ll use specialized equipment to dry your property, including dehumidifiers and air movers. Our team will work to ensure that your property is completely dry and free of moisture, which is crucial for preventing mold and mildew growth.
Step 4: Cleaning and Disinfection
We’ll thoroughly clean and disinfect your property to remove any remaining water and prevent the growth of mold and mildew. Our team will also check for any signs of damage to your walls, floors, and ceilings.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Touch-ups
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ure that your property is completely dry and free of moisture. We’ll also make any necessary touch-ups to ensure that your home is restored to its pre-leak condition.

Water Heater Leak Water Removal Cost in Lincoln, AR
The cost of water heater leak water removal in Lincoln, AR can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our team will provide a detailed estimate for your specific situation.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ction | $500 – $2,500 | The size of the affected area and the amount of water extracted. |
| Drying and d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| The size of the affected area and the type of equipment used. |
| Cleaning and disinfection |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area and the type of cleaning products used. |
| Final inspection and touch-ups | $500 – $1,000 | The size of the affected area and the type of repairs needed. |
| Hidden water damage detection | $1,000 – $3,000 | The size of the affected area and the type of equipment used. |
| Mold or mildew remediation | $2,000 – $5,000 | The size of the affected area and the type of remediation needed. |
